Nadezhda Besfamilnaya

Nadezhda Viktorovna Besfamilnaja (Russian Надежда Викторовна Бесфамильная, English transcription Nadezhda Besfamilnaya; . * December 27, 1950 in Moscow) is a former Soviet sprinter.

At the European Athletics Championships in 1971, she finished fourth on 200 m and won the 4 x 100 meters relay with the Soviet team bronze.

The following year, she was disqualified at the Olympic Games in Munich in 1972 from more than 200 m in the semi-finals and came in the 4 x 100 meters relay with the Soviet team to fifth place.

At the Olympic Games in Montreal in 1976, it reached more than 100 m the quarter-finals and more than 200 m the semi-finals. In the 4 x 100 - meter relay team brought them to the Soviet quartet bronze.

Three times she was Soviet champion in the 100 m ( 1971 to 1973 ) and four times more than 200 m (1969, 1971, 1972, 1975). In the hall she won twice the national title over 60 m (1972, 1973).

Personal Best

  • 60 m (Hall ): 7.1 s, March 2, 1974, Moscow
  • 100 m: 11.2 s, June 3, 1971, Riga
  • 200 m: 22.8 s, August 12, 1972, Moscow
